The Brand Agency wins media and creative account for The Perth Mint

The Brand Agency has become The Perth Mint’s creative and media agency of record.

The announcement:

The Perth Mint appoints The Brand Agency

PERTH – TUESDAY 9 OCTOBER: Following a competitive tender process, The Brand Agency has been appointed by The Perth Mint as its sole advertising and media agency. In a remit encompassing all of The Brand Agency’s capabilities from creative and media, through to content and destination marketing, the appointment signals an increased focus by The Perth Mint on its national and global marketing.

James Ross, The Perth Mint, group manager, marketing services said: “This is a really exciting time for the Mint, with new product launches occurring in Australia and overseas, complimenting our global $18billion plus minted products program. We are delighted to have found a Perth-based agency with the skills, commitment and resources to help us deliver on our mandate to take Australian precious metals to the world.”

“The Perth Mint is one of Western Australia’s most iconic and important businesses and an organisation that has no peers in this country. They have a focus on growth which provides a fantastic opportunity for a business like ours to help them achieve this, both nationally and internationally across their diverse product mix. It’s not often that you get to work with a Western Australian business that is a world leader and we are very excited about what we can achieve together,” said Nick Bayes, The Brand Agency general manager.

This win follows hot on the heals of the launch of The Brand Agency’s destination marketing division headed led by Gwyn Dolphin, previously the CEO of Tourism WA. This offering, within the Brand Agency, has been created to provide strategic guidance to organisations operating in the tourism, entertainment and events sectors and has already picked up a number of major projects including the rebrand of the City of Kalgoorlie-Boulder.
